What happened to the Enterprise "In a Mirror Darly" sequel novel that was supposed to be written? The last i had heard it was being worked on by a number of writers
 
Re: UPCOMING/MISSING PROJECTS

Kurgan said:
What happened to the Enterprise "In a Mirror Darly" sequel novel that was supposed to be written? The last i had heard it was being worked on by a number of writers
Age of the Empress: The Reign of Sato I, by Mike Sussman with Dayton Ward and Kevin Dilmore, is part of Glass Empires, the first Mirror Universe collection, and should be available in bookstores this month.
 
Re: UPCOMING/MISSING PROJECTS

Kurgan said:
What happened to the Enterprise "In a Mirror Darly" sequel novel that was supposed to be written? The last i had heard it was being worked on by a number of writers

That is the first story of the STAR TREK: MIRROR UNIVERSE--Glass Empires trade paperback, out this month. Log onto startrekbooks.com for a preview.

The trade also has an Original Series story by David Mack, and a TNG story by Greg Cox.

^ Which will be followed next month by Star Trek: Mirror Universe: Obsidian Alliances, which will have a Voyager tale by Keith R.A. DeCandido (that's me :D), a New Frontier tale by Peter David, and a DS9 story by Sarah Shaw. Cha cha cha.
